The Honorable Albert S. Camplese is the Judge and Clerk of the Ashtabula County Probate Court. This Court of Common Pleas Judgeship is an elected position with a six year term. As the Clerk of the Probate Court, the Judge is responsible for keeping and maintaining all records and filings in the Probate Court.

Mediation of Domestic Relations cases are coordinated through the Family Court Services (FCS) Department. Mediations are conducted by the FCS staff as well as the staff of the Joint Court Mediation Project. Parties may also request mediation by a private mediator.
